« Back to run

Function Details

Civi\Api4\Generic\AbstractAction::__call

Current function

Function Call Count Self Wall Time Self CPU Self Memory Usage Self Peak Memory Usage Inclusive Wall Time Inclusive CPU Inclusive Memory Usage Inclusive Peak Memory Usage
Civi\Api4\Generic\AbstractAction::__call
Percent of total request
6681 17,980 µs 18,698 µs 401,136 bytes bytes 161,950 µs
(7 %)
158,137 µs
(7 %)
1,320,472 bytes
(9 %)
bytes
(0 %)

Parent functions

Function Call Count Self Wall Time Self CPU Self Memory Usage Self Peak Memory Usage Inclusive Wall Time Inclusive CPU Inclusive Memory Usage Inclusive Peak Memory Usage
Civi\API\Request::create
Percent of total request
101 2,038 µs 1,251 µs 39,584 bytes 632 bytes 1,574,253 µs
(65 %)
1,349,199 µs
(63 %)
7,948,664 bytes
(53 %)
7,257,112 bytes
(46 %)
Civi\Api4\Generic\AbstractAction::offsetGet
Percent of total request
896 2,516 µs 2,414 µs 31,528 bytes bytes 7,190 µs
(0 %)
4,829 µs
(0 %)
137,656 bytes
(1 %)
bytes
(0 %)
Civi\Api4\Event\Subscriber\PermissionCheckSubscriber::onApiAuthor…
Percent of total request
37 818 µs µs -3,024 bytes 256 bytes 15,430 µs
(1 %)
18,020 µs
(1 %)
12,792 bytes
(0 %)
256 bytes
(0 %)
Civi\Api4\Event\Subscriber\ValidateFieldsSubscriber::onApiPrepare…
Percent of total request
37 1,919 µs 1,000 µs -33,680 bytes 696 bytes 5,066 µs
(0 %)
5,006 µs
(0 %)
7,352 bytes
(0 %)
832 bytes
(0 %)
CRM_Core_BAO_Translation::hook_civicrm_apiWrappers
Percent of total request
42 140 µs µs -1,640 bytes bytes 358 µs
(0 %)
µs
(0 %)
1,264 bytes
(0 %)
bytes
(0 %)
Civi\Api4\Generic\BasicGetAction::filterArray
Percent of total request
32 3,883 µs 999 µs -424,416 bytes bytes 45,988 µs
(2 %)
42,980 µs
(2 %)
518,016 bytes
(3 %)
bytes
(0 %)
Civi\Api4\Generic\BasicGetAction::evaluateFilters
Percent of total request
2489 9,111 µs 9,023 µs 777,296 bytes bytes 41,810 µs
(2 %)
41,981 µs
(2 %)
939,784 bytes
(6 %)
bytes
(0 %)
Civi\Api4\Generic\BasicGetAction::sortArray
Percent of total request
32 118 µs µs -1,384 bytes bytes 330 µs
(0 %)
994 µs
(0 %)
1,248 bytes
(0 %)
bytes
(0 %)
Civi\Api4\Generic\BasicGetAction::queryArray
Percent of total request
32 641 µs µs -259,728 bytes bytes 234,637 µs
(10 %)
235,724 µs
(11 %)
6,456,952 bytes
(43 %)
157,808 bytes
(1 %)
Civi\Api4\Generic\BasicGetAction::limitArray
Percent of total request
32 166 µs µs -3,432 bytes bytes 567 µs
(0 %)
1,997 µs
(0 %)
1,248 bytes
(0 %)
bytes
(0 %)
Civi\Api4\Generic\BasicGetAction::selectArray
Percent of total request
32 115,712 µs 101,114 µs 6,188,208 bytes 157,808 bytes 186,923 µs
(8 %)
189,753 µs
(9 %)
6,193,536 bytes
(41 %)
157,808 bytes
(1 %)
Civi\Api4\Generic\DAOGetAction::getObjects
Percent of total request
32 858 µs µs -72,888 bytes bytes 140,500 µs
(6 %)
129,483 µs
(6 %)
6,435,288 bytes
(43 %)
193,336 bytes
(1 %)
Civi\Api4\Query\Api4Query::getGroupBy
Percent of total request
64 242 µs µs -2,864 bytes bytes 632 µs
(0 %)
µs
(0 %)
1,816 bytes
(0 %)
bytes
(0 %)
Civi\Api4\Query\Api4Query::getSelect
Percent of total request
64 218 µs µs -2,848 bytes bytes 701 µs
(0 %)
997 µs
(0 %)
1,832 bytes
(0 %)
bytes
(0 %)
Civi\Api4\Query\Api4Query::getCheckPermissions
Percent of total request
2273 4,928 µs 3,999 µs -180,576 bytes bytes 17,787 µs
(1 %)
18,980 µs
(1 %)
1,864 bytes
(0 %)
bytes
(0 %)
Civi\Api4\Query\Api4Query::getWhere
Percent of total request
96 281 µs µs -4,328 bytes bytes 1,016 µs
(0 %)
977 µs
(0 %)
2,400 bytes
(0 %)
bytes
(0 %)
Civi\Api4\Query\Api4Query::getOrderBy
Percent of total request
32 116 µs 1,002 µs -1,400 bytes bytes 385 µs
(0 %)
1,002 µs
(0 %)
1,232 bytes
(0 %)
bytes
(0 %)
Civi\Api4\Query\Api4Query::getLimit
Percent of total request
32 109 µs µs -1,400 bytes bytes 300 µs
(0 %)
µs
(0 %)
1,232 bytes
(0 %)
bytes
(0 %)
Civi\Api4\Query\Api4Query::getOffset
Percent of total request
32 103 µs µs -1,400 bytes bytes 292 µs
(0 %)
µs
(0 %)
1,232 bytes
(0 %)
bytes
(0 %)
Civi\Api4\Query\Api4Query::getHaving
Percent of total request
32 98 µs µs -1,384 bytes bytes 302 µs
(0 %)
1,002 µs
(0 %)
1,248 bytes
(0 %)
bytes
(0 %)
Civi\Api4\Query\Api4Query::debug
Percent of total request
32 118 µs µs -1,400 bytes bytes 307 µs
(0 %)
µs
(0 %)
1,232 bytes
(0 %)
bytes
(0 %)
Civi\Api4\Provider\ActionObjectProvider::handleChains
Percent of total request
32 134 µs µs -1,384 bytes bytes 346 µs
(0 %)
µs
(0 %)
1,264 bytes
(0 %)
bytes
(0 %)

Child functions

Function Call Count Inclusive Wall Time Inclusive CPU Inclusive Memory Usage Inclusive Peak Memory Usage
Civi\Api4\Generic\AbstractAction::paramExists 6681 22,706 µs 27,585 µs 4,928 bytes bytes
Civi\Api4\Generic\AbstractAction::getParamInfo 127 120,945 µs 111,854 µs 913,808 bytes bytes
Civi\Api4\Utils\ReflectionUtils::castTypeSoftly 127 319 µs µs 600 bytes bytes